A TRAIN derailment at Carnforth station caused widespread delays on the Furness and West coast lines yesterday (July 20) morning.
Twenty-three trains were cancelled and an extra 89 were delayed for around half an hour each after a train left the tracks during engineering work at around 8:20am on Sunday morning.
Nobody was injured in the incident.
